Barazo lexicon schemas and TypeScript types
barazo.forum
1name: Deploy to Staging
2
3on:
4 push:
5 branches:
6 - main
7
8permissions: {}
9
10jobs:
11 trigger-deploy:
12 name: Trigger Staging Deploy
13 runs-on: ubuntu-latest
14 steps:
15 - name: Dispatch to barazo-deploy
16 uses: peter-evans/repository-dispatch@28959ce8df70de7be546dd1250a005dd32156697 # v4.0.1
17 with:
18 token: ${{ secrets.DEPLOY_PAT }}
19 repository: singi-labs/barazo-deploy
20 event-type: deploy-staging
21 client-payload: |
22 {
23 "trigger_repo": "barazo-lexicons",
24 "api_ref": "main",
25 "web_ref": "main"
26 }
27
28 - name: Sync workspace lockfile
29 uses: peter-evans/repository-dispatch@28959ce8df70de7be546dd1250a005dd32156697 # v4.0.1
30 with:
31 token: ${{ secrets.DEPLOY_PAT }}
32 repository: singi-labs/barazo-workspace
33 event-type: sync-lockfile